OpenAI Plugins Web开发:使用Hyperframes与Remotion插件创建现代化Web应用
【免费下载链接】pluginsOpenAI Plugins项目地址: https://gitcode.com/GitHub_Trending/plugins123/plugins
OpenAI Plugins为Web开发带来了革命性的效率提升,其中Hyperframes和Remotion插件是构建现代化Web应用的强大工具。本文将介绍如何利用这两款插件快速开发高质量Web应用,无需复杂的代码编写,让新手也能轻松上手。
为什么选择Hyperframes与Remotion插件?
在众多OpenAI Plugins中,Hyperframes和Remotion脱颖而出,成为Web开发者的理想选择。Hyperframes是一个开源框架,能够将HTML转换为视频,为Web应用增添动态视觉效果。而Remotion则专注于视频创建,允许开发者使用React构建复杂的动画和视频内容。
Hyperframes框架Logo:开源HTML转视频解决方案
Remotion视频创建工具Logo:基于React的视频开发框架
快速开始:安装与配置
要开始使用这两款插件,首先需要克隆项目仓库:
git clone https://gitcode.com/GitHub_Trending/plugins123/pluginsHyperframes安装
Hyperframes的安装过程非常简单,只需运行以下命令:
cd plugins/hyperframes npm installRemotion项目初始化
Remotion提供了便捷的项目脚手架工具,帮助你快速创建新的视频项目:
cd plugins/remotion npx create-remotion-app my-video-project cd my-video-project npm installHyperframes:HTML转视频的魔法
Hyperframes的核心功能是将普通HTML转换为高质量视频。这对于创建产品演示、教程或营销材料非常有用。使用Hyperframes,你可以:
- 将网页动态效果转化为视频
- 添加自定义动画和过渡效果
- 支持响应式设计,确保在不同设备上的最佳显示效果
Hyperframes的使用流程非常直观:
- 创建或导入HTML文件
- 配置视频参数(分辨率、帧率等)
- 运行转换命令生成视频
- 导出或集成到Web应用中
Remotion:React驱动的视频创作
Remotion将React的强大功能带入视频创作领域。通过使用熟悉的React组件模型,开发者可以轻松创建复杂的动画和视频序列。Remotion的主要特性包括:
- 基于React组件的视频构建
- 精确的时间控制和动画效果
- 支持3D内容、图表和数据可视化
- 丰富的文本动画和过渡效果
基本Remotion组件示例
Remotion提供了多种预建组件,如<Img>、<Video>和<Audio>,确保资源在渲染前完全加载:
import { Img, Video, Audio } from "remotion"; function MyVideo() { return ( <div> <Img src="image.jpg" /> <Video src="background.mp4" /> <Audio src="narration.mp3" /> </div> ); }实战案例:创建动态数据可视化
结合Hyperframes和Remotion,我们可以创建引人入胜的数据可视化Web应用。例如,使用Remotion的图表功能创建动态数据展示,然后通过Hyperframes将其转换为视频,嵌入到网页中。
Remotion支持多种图表类型,包括:
- 柱状图
- 饼图
- 折线图
- 股票图表
相关实现可以在plugins/remotion/skills/remotion/rules/charts.md中找到详细指南。
高级技巧:动画与过渡效果
无论是Hyperframes还是Remotion,都提供了丰富的动画和过渡效果选项。Remotion特别擅长文本动画和场景过渡,可以创建专业级的视觉效果。一些实用的动画技巧包括:
- 使用CSS关键帧动画
- 实现平滑的场景切换
- 添加文字逐字显示效果
- 同步音频和视觉元素
详细的动画指南可以参考plugins/remotion/skills/remotion/rules/animations.md和plugins/remotion/skills/remotion/rules/text-animations.md。
总结:提升Web开发效率的终极工具
Hyperframes和Remotion插件为Web开发带来了全新的可能性。它们不仅简化了复杂动画和视频内容的创建过程,还允许开发者使用熟悉的技术栈(HTML和React)来实现这些效果。无论你是新手还是有经验的开发者,这些工具都能帮助你快速构建出令人印象深刻的现代化Web应用。
通过OpenAI Plugins生态系统,我们可以期待未来会有更多创新工具出现,进一步推动Web开发的边界。现在就开始探索Hyperframes和Remotion,开启你的高效Web开发之旅吧!
【免费下载链接】pluginsOpenAI Plugins项目地址: https://gitcode.com/GitHub_Trending/plugins123/plugins
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考